The 2008 season is the 86th season of competitive football in Ecuador.
National leagues
Serie A
- Champion: Deportivo Quito (3rd title)
- International cup qualifiers:
- Relegated: Universidad Católica, Deportivo Azogues
Serie B
- Winner: Manta (1st title)
- Promoted: Manta, LDU Portoviejo
- Relegated: LDU Cuenca, Brasilia
Segunda
- Winner: Rocafuerte
- Promoted: Rocafuerte, Atlético Audaz
Clubs in international competitions
| Team | 2008 Copa Libertadores | 2008 Copa Sudamericana | 2008 FIFA Club WC |
|---|---|---|---|
| Deportivo Cuenca | Eliminated in the Second Stage | N/A | N/A |
| Deportivo Quito | N/A | Eliminated in the First Stage | N/A |
| LDU Quito | Champion | Eliminated in the Round of 16 | Runner-up |
| Olmedo | Eliminated in the First Stage | N/A | N/A |

Women's U-20 team
The women's U-20 team participated in the South American Women's U-20 tournament in Brazil. They were drawn into Group A and finished third in the group; they failed to advance.
